FilmCam is a disposable camera on your phone. Wind the dial, shoot the roll, send it to the lab, and wait about a day for your photos to come back developed. There is no preview after the shutter. You get a viewfinder, a frame counter and the small mechanical sound of the wind wheel, and then you wait, which is the part that makes the photos feel like something you found instead of something you made. Two film stocks are free forever, with no limit on how many rolls you shoot. The camera costs $14.99 once and opens the other six. THE FREE FILM Gold 200. Warm everyday color, 24 shots. Dream 100. Faded, hazy, one of a kind, 16 shots. THE REST OF THE FILM Portrait 400. Soft, natural skin, 36 shots. Street 200. Cool, muted street tones, 36 shots. Mono 400. Black and white, 24 shots. Slide 50. Punchy, saturated, deep blues, 36 shots. Cine 500T. Teal shadows, warm skin, glowing lights, 24 shots. Night 800. Pushed, cool and grainy after dark, 36 shots. Every stock develops on its own recipe: its own grain size, its own halation around bright lights, its own split tone, vignette and print softness. The film you load also sets how many frames you get, the way real cartridges do. THE LAB Your first roll ever comes back in about an hour, so you see the payoff the day you install. Every roll after that takes 18 to 24 hours. Roughly one roll in eight gets rushed and lands early, which is luck, not a setting. Nobody can pay to skip the wait. We wrote the app and we can't skip it either. Your phone tells you when the roll is ready. THE RULES OF FILM The stock commits on your first shot. No swapping film mid-roll. Rolls develop in the order you finish them. Prints shared from the free camera carry a small FilmCam mark printed up the white border, the way a maker's name runs along the edge of a real 35mm strip. It is never on the photograph itself. WHAT ELSE An optional quartz date stamp, burned into the corner in the orange seven-segment type your parents' photos had. Save a whole developed roll to Photos at once, or leave everything in the app. Nothing to sign into, no account, no ads. One purchase, $14.99. No subscription.
